Following a suggestion from Prof. (ETH-Hçnggerberg, Zürich) that Scheme 4 was incorrect, the authors carefully examined the relationship between the conformations of 5 and 7 and the NMR data (see Figure 1). They concluded that the assignments of 5 (6) and 7 (8) must be reversed; 3b-hydroxy derivative for 5 and 6, but 3a-hyroxy forms for 7 and 8.The authors apologize deeply for their mistakes.
